Hi Leonard, On 4/1/20 11:33 PM, Leonard Crestez wrote: > There is no single device which can represent the imx interconnect. > Instead of adding a virtual one just make the main &noc act as the > global interconnect provider. > > The imx interconnect provider driver will scale the NOC and DDRC based > on bandwidth request.
